  • 97TA Cutout..where to mount

    Im going to mount it on passenger side of a 97TA...wondering where people mount them so i can still use a E-cutout eventually. pics or description would be nice. Thanks!
    just a bolt-on Lt1

  • #2
    Well to make sure it has a purpose you should mount it after the y merges and before the muffler unless your doing dual cutouts.
